For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public elementary school serving 315 students in Foxburg, PA.
The top-ranked public elementary school in Foxburg, PA is Allegheny-clarion Valley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Foxburg, PA public elementary school have an average math proficiency score of 42% (versus the Pennsylvania public elementary school average of 39%), and reading proficiency score of 62% (versus the 54% statewide average). Elementary schools in Foxburg have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of Pennsylvania public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 3% of the student body (majority Black and Hispanic), which is less than the Pennsylvania public elementary school average of 42% (majority Hispanic and Black).
